Output 8316c6ea461d95a59f76e2780ff44adea89467017b5b7c5ce0c1d9b4a2047a0e:1

value
587366
script pubkey
OP_0 OP_PUSHBYTES_20 daf916c73803c1bffef99478b3d33db9b76d6371
address
bc1qmtu3d3ecq0qmllhej3ut85eahxmk6cm3qc0x6n
transaction
8316c6ea461d95a59f76e2780ff44adea89467017b5b7c5ce0c1d9b4a2047a0e